:) We are headed home to OKW March 6-13. Ah to be "home again". My very first trip to WDW was in March a very long time ago (1980). On our first day at MK (the only park back then) it was 26 degrees out! I wore several layers of clothes intending to peal the layers as it got warmer. (It never got above 40 and I kept my coat on.) I had fun watching all those other northerners who had left warm coats etc. at home and were scurrying to buy sweatshirts! The Cinderella fountain at the castle had icicles haging down, Space Mountain was down because of power problems. Many area schools were closed because they had power outages. The orange groves were in crisis mode with smudge pots and sprayers going full blast. It was a unique experience. Since then I have had 80 degree weather in February, March and December and 40 degree weather anytime. I always bring layers and a bit of everything from shorts to sweats and raingear. The Atlanta Braves play their [home]spring training games at Disney's Wide World of Sports. You can get advanced tkts. thru Ticketmaster, but I bet you can just walk up and get tkts. at the gate for the less "popular" teams. We haven't seen the Braves yet, but we do love spring training games in FL in March. Last yr., we drove from WDW to Tampa to see the Yankees at Legends Field. When we were at VB, we saw the Dodgers vs. NY Mets at Dodgertown, a genuine spring training ballpark. I've been reading a little about Wide World of Sports. It is a state-of-the-art field w/ an amazing drainage system, so games rarely get rained out. I also read that they have a "Peanuts & Crackerjacks" stand.
